Asynchronous Communications (Camera Link) Interface; Definition Of The Transfer Protocol - Dalsa 1M28-SA User Manual

One megapixel cmos stop action camera family
Hide thumbs Also See for 1M28-SA:
Table of Contents

Advertisement

1M28, 1M75, and 1M150 User's Manual
Asynchronous Communications
Asynchronous Communications
Asynchronous Communications
Asynchronous Communications
(Camera Link) Interface
(Camera Link
(Camera Link
(Camera Link
The asynchronous communications serial communicator interface is part of Camera Link. (Refer to
the Camera Link Specification for more information). This interface is often used in industrial
image processing for controlling camera settings. The following communication settings from the
asynchronous serial communications protocol have been chosen for the 1MXXX camera series:
Baud rate
Startbit
data bits
Parity
Stopbit
In the idle state the leads RX and TX are characterised by a standard H-level. Data transfer begins
with a startbit, which has an L-level. Next, the 8 data bits are transmitted in the sequence from
D0...D7. The parity bit follows the data. In order to separate subsequent data, a stop bit of H-level
is added. The total number of cycles necessary for data transfer is 11. After the data transfer,
signals return to the idle state.

Definition of the Transfer Protocol

Due to the 8-bit RS232 limitation, it is not possible to distinguish between data and address
transfers. The protocol in Table 28 is implemented to allow access to the 64 internal camera
registers.
Table 28: Communications Protocol
RS232 Communication
Protocol
Command to camera
controller
WRITE Address
WRITE Data Low Nibble
WRITE Data High Nibble
READ Data of Addresses
x:
Ai: Address bits
Dj: Data bits
When data or addresses are written (WRITE Mode), the RS232 interface of the camera answers
with ACK = 06H if the transfer was successful, or with NAK = 15H if the transfer failed.
Therefore, it is possible to control the complete transfer process by the software. When a register is
DALSA
PRELIMINARY
9600
1
8
None
1
don't care
Appendix B
Appendix B
Appendix B
Appendix B
) Interface
) Interface
) Interface
Data bits
7
6
5
4
0
1
A5
A4
1
0
x
x
1
1
x
x
0
0
A5
A4
3
2
1
0
A3
A2
A1
A0
D3
D2
D1
D0
D7
D6
D5
D4
A3
A2
A1
A0
03-32-00525-04
61

Hide quick links:

Advertisement

Table of Contents
loading

This manual is also suitable for:

1m75-sa1m150-sa

Table of Contents